I'm a first time mommy, my daughter is 8 months old. Here are some tips I've put together to help anyone who needs it (& it might make you laugh too).
1. You can NEVER take too many pictures of your new baby. Take as many as you want!
2. For the first month or so, it's ok to keep checking them to make sure they're breathing.
3. Get used to lots of messes....especially smelly ones.
4. If you think they're sick, and have any question about whether to take them to the doctor or not....TAKE THEM. We really do have maternal instincts.
5. Don't be afraid to ask your pediatrician questions. That's what they're there for.
6. Keep up to date on the car seat requirements, they change frequently.
7. Babies will eat when they're hungry & they know when they've had enough.
8. They will most likely say "dada" first. As much as us moms try & hope, it's just easier for them to form the "d" sound than the "m" sound.
9. Don't worry that your not going to be a good mommy, it will come to you...and you'll be the only one they have, and you'll be the perfect one for them.
10. Kiss them a million times every day, at least until they'll still let you!
